This seminar focuses on researching in the foreign language classroom. It prepares you for the research projects which you will have to conduct during your Praxissemester. We'll start by idendifying various topics in and around learning and teaching English in primary school, which are worth researching. We will explore these issues with the help of video material from authentic classrooms. After that, attention will be paid to various approaches to research, including research methods, research design, research instruments, etc. You will apply your knowledge by drafting your own research project.
